Unless your neighborhood kid is seriously into cars and quite mature for their age (ie, they appreciate the value of a car), I would not just have a neighborhood kid do the job. You might as well take it to the car wash and have them spritz on the all-in-one spray.
Seriously, I would avoid hiring someone who doesn't know what they're doing (ie, neighborhood kid). You're MUCH better doing it yourself with little or no experience. At least you'll stop if you notice you're doing something wrong. Hire the neighborhood kid to mow the lawn, pull weeds, etc., and use the time you save to work on your car. It's really not that hard. It just takes a little patience and being careful. Do a little research on this board or carcareonline (see my prior post for warning on this site) on the best type of wax to use for your circumstance, go buy the necessary supplies, and block off a Sat/Sun afternoon to take care of your car.
